Some homes just make you breathe a bit slower when you walk in. This one bedroom apartment in DT1, right in the heart of Downtown Dubai, does exactly that. I remember stepping in for the first time toward the end of the afternoon, and everything felt calm as the last bit of sunlight drifted in through those big floor to ceiling windows. You barely hear the city from up here and yet, you know you are in the center of it all. It is kind of the best of both worlds, honestly.
When I think about apartments for sale in Downtown Dubai, so many of them look great in photos but feel a little too polished when you see them in real life. This place surprised me. The kitchen actually feels like somewhere you would cook without thinking twice about it. The layout just works – you get proper counter space, those sleek, easy open cabinets, and the storage actually makes sense. Sometimes, apartments in Dubai make you wonder where to put even your coffee mugs. Not here. I brewed a cup the last time I visited and just stood there for a minute, watching the city lights start to come on outside. It all feels easy, not forced.
Move towards the dining area, and you notice there is enough room for a few friends but nothing feels crowded. I could picture having a couple of people over, or just setting out breakfast for two in the morning with sunlight coming through the glass. The living room is a bit of a showstopper. Those windows really do run tall, and if you pause there for a bit, you can see the Burj Khalifa almost glowing as the sun catches it. At night, the city feels alive and all those little lights across Downtown Dubai blend into something you could watch for ages. It is the sort of spot where sometimes you lose track of your phone because you are too busy just looking out.
Now about the bedroom. It is tucked away enough to feel private. This is not one of those apartments where it just feels like an afterthought jammed in. There is space for a proper bed and actual wardrobes where you can fit more than just a handful of shirts. When I checked out the bathroom, that spa vibe hit me. Not in a grand, overdone way, but it just feels like you have room to spread your things out, do your morning routine without knocking into every surface. These small things really make a difference day to day.
One little thing I noticed – when you walk in, the entrance feels open. Not a cramped hallway. There is a nice, warm palette in here too. The floors feel soft under your feet, and the greys and sand tones give everything a welcome, cozy feel. You sense they thought about how someone would actually live here, not just how it would look in a brochure.
Building-wise, DT1 is known in Downtown Dubai for its amenities, but honestly it is the atmosphere you feel. The gym is more than just an afterthought with light, real equipment, and actual space to move around. I have seen people finish up a workout and just hang out upstairs on the rooftop deck, watching the sun go down over the skyline. Rooftop in this building has a quiet social buzz, and if you want privacy, there is always a corner to yourself. The pool gets real morning swimmers, not just people snapping photos.
The location really sets this apartment apart if you want Downtown Dubai convenience. The Dubai Opera is just a walk away. Sometimes on warm evenings, you catch a bit of music drifting over. Dubai Mall is practically next door, so if you run out of milk or want to wander and people watch, it is just down the street. Plus, weekend mornings bring a fun buzz as people spill out to coffee shops or stroll little parks right below the building. Kids, neighbors, people with their dogs, you see it all.
After seeing a lot of apartments for sale in Dubai, there is something honest about this DT1 space. It is modern and smart, but never cold or too minimal.
